Many homeowners turn to log home landscaping to address common issues such as uneven terrain, poor drainage, or overgrown vegetation. Over time, natural landscapes can become difficult to navigate or unsightly, detracting from the home's overall appearance. Landscaping professionals can resolve these problems by leveling uneven ground, installing proper drainage solutions, and removing invasive or overgrown plants. These improvements not only enhance the property's aesthetics but also help protect the foundation and prevent issues like erosion or water damage.

The overview below groups typical Log Home Landscaping proj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Glenview, IL.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Smaller Landscaping Enhancements - Basic landscaping work such as planting new shrubs or installing small garden beds typically costs between $250 and $600. Many routine projects fall within this range, depending on the scope and materials used.
Medium-Scale Landscaping Projects - Larger landscaping tasks like installing patios, walkways, or multiple plantings generally range from $1,000 to $3,500. These projects are common for homeowners seeking to improve outdoor aesthetics and functionality.
Full Landscape Overhauls - Complete landscape redesigns, including extensive planting, hardscape features, and grading, can range from $4,000 to $10,000 or more. Fewer projects reach into the highest tiers, which are reserved for complex, custom designs.
Custom and Complex Work - Highly customized landscaping services, such as integrating water features or large retaining walls, often exceed $10,000 and can reach $20,000+ depending on the size and complexity. These projects are less common but available through local service providers for larger properties or specialized designs.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
